What Hot Stone Massage actually is
Smooth, heated basalt stones are placed on key points of the body and used as massage tools. The warmth penetrates deeper than hands alone, releasing tight muscles and calming the nervous system. Ideal for cooler months and stress-heavy weeks.
Hot Stone Massage sessions in the UAE typically run 75 minutes from check-in to checkout (including the steam, treatment, rinse and rest stages where applicable). Pricing varies widely — budget neighbourhood spas start around AED 250, while five-star hotel spas can go up to AED 750+ for signature versions of the same treatment.
Who it's for
Hot Stone Massage is recommended for: deep muscle relaxation; improved circulation; reduced stress hormones; eases joint stiffness. It's particularly well-suited to desk workers, athletes, anyone with chronic neck/back pain, post-flight travellers and stressed parents.
Best avoided if: you have recent surgery, deep vein issues, or a recent injury (check with a doctor first). Pregnant? Look for prenatal-certified providers — Spalist lists them under the Prenatal Massage category.
How a typical Hot Stone Massage session goes
Step 1 (5 min): Brief consultation — pressure preference, problem areas, allergies. Step 2 (5 min): Change, lie down on a heated table under a sheet. Step 3 (45–75 min): The treatment itself. Speak up about pressure or sensitive areas. Step 4 (5–10 min): Quiet rest, water. Step 5: You leave relaxed but not rushed.
What to look for in a great provider
Three signs of quality: (1) Therapist training, ask about their certification and how long they've been practising. (2) Hygiene visible at a glance — clean linens between every client, disposable underwear/slippers offered, surfaces wiped. (3) Time, the treatment runs the full advertised duration, not rushed to fit another client.
Red flags: aggressive pre-treatment upselling, the spa's WhatsApp number being a personal mobile (not a business line), prices significantly under market rate without explanation, no visible licence on the wall (UAE law requires it). Before and after care
Before: hydrate well, avoid heavy meals in the previous 90 minutes, communicate any injuries. After: drink water (lots. Massage releases toxins), eat a light meal, avoid intense exercise for 12 hours.
Pricing across the UAE
Hot Stone Massage pricing in the UAE in 2026 spans roughly AED 250 to AED 750 for a 75-minute session. Budget tier (under AED 200) sits in older neighbourhood clusters like Karama, Deira and Sharjah's industrial areas. Mid-range (AED 200–500) dominates in Marina, JBR, Jumeirah and the Sharjah corniche districts.
